Runbook — account recovery, Calqary formula sandbox. Welcome aboard! Quick context: user-supplied formulas run inside the Pebblebox sandbox, and the recovery service account is the only identity allowed to reset sandbox policy bundles. If that account gets locked (usually after a failed policy push), don't file a ticket — recover it yourself. Verify the sandbox pods are healthy first, then run the recovery CLI from the ops bastion. When the CLI prompts for credentials, supply the recovery passphrase shown just below.

unlock words, yawig-kagef: gordor-holvan-ulaael-pramir-ulaiel-tamdor

RESTRICTED: Managers Only — Revised Commission Scheme

Finance: the new scheme replaces flat 4% with tiered payout — 3% to quota, 6% above, capped at 150% of target. Multi-year Pelorus contracts earn a 1.2x accelerator. Clawbacks apply to cancellations within 90 days. Effective start of next fiscal year; current-year deals grandfathered. Model the cash impact against both the conservative and stretch bookings scenarios and flag variances over 5%. The strategic reasoning, which must stay within this page's audience, is noted below.

board note of kageg-bahof: The renewal with Holwynax Holdings closes at $2 million a year, 5 percent below the last contract. Project Ulaath slips by two quarters because of the supplier delay.

This fragment governs transport of the sealed bid for the Marrowgate civic works tender, prepared by Oxhall Engineering. The bid envelope is wax-sealed, double-bagged, and must remain in the driver's direct custody from collection to lodgement — no transfer between vehicles, no overnight holds. The coordinator confirms the lodgement window before dispatch and again one hour prior to arrival, as late bids are void without appeal. Photograph the intact seals at both ends. On arrival, the courier applies the hand-over instruction recorded below.

handover note for yagef-bagep: the drudor pelius courier leaves the kasdor zorvan norir ledger at gate 8016 under passcode 755406